Baahubali 2's 12mn is on higher ticket than usual for Telugu version reaching $40 in 1st weekend. Footfalls will be par or lower than Dangal which grossed $12.6mn in 2016. Yeah an Oscar buzz film will do well in USA but not in India or even with diaspora audience. Then it will be doing for overseas audience only. Prime example is "The Lunchbox" by Irrfan Khan. It did really well in overseas, grossing $20mn IIRC outside India but India & diaspora audience hardly paid attention. It did $4.25mn in USA, par that in France and India.
